- Pack Light but Essential
Avoid overpacking by focusing only on must-haves: snacks, wipes, refillable water bottles, and a change of clothes for each child. Don’t forget books, toys, or tablets for entertainment—another essential family travel hack. - Plan Smart, But Stay Flexible
Research family-friendly hotels and attractions ahead of time, but leave room in your itinerary for unexpected changes. Flexibility makes travel less stressful when nap times run long or plans shift. - Time Your Travel Right
Schedule flights or road trips around nap times or bedtime whenever possible. Sleeping kids mean calmer parents and a smoother journey. - Snacks = Sanity
Children are happiest when they’re comfortable and well-fed. Carry healthy snacks like fruit, granola bars, or crackers to avoid hunger-related meltdowns. This is one of the simplest family travel hacks that saves money and keeps everyone happy. - Build in Breaks
On road trips, plan short stops at parks or rest areas. During flights, encourage kids to stretch or walk the aisle. Breaks are essential for releasing energy and reducing crankiness. - Give Kids a Role
Allow children to carry a small backpack, choose a snack, or help decide on activities. When kids feel involved, they’re less likely to complain. - Create Fun Memories Along the Way
Turn travel into part of the adventure. Play car games, listen to audiobooks, or take family selfies. These little activities make the journey itself just as special as the destination.
